When Suzanne accepts Grace's invitation to a luxurious corporate weekend retreat, she believes she's in for some first class pampering, but when one of the participants dies soon after they arrive, she's thrown back into the world of detecting, whether she likes it or not. To make matters worse, they are soon cut off from the rest of the world, and the group finds itself trapped on a mountaintop with a cold blooded killer.

When Mayor George Morris's chief rival, Harley Boggess, is found murdered while sitting behind the mayor's desk in city hall, it looks as though George may have dispatched his competition permanently. When the mayor goes missing immediately afterwards, things appear to be even worse, and it's up to Suzanne, her mother, and Grace to work together to uncover who really killed the councilman before the mayor's future-and his freedom-are extinguished...

When Crazy Dan the junk man, is found murdered in his shop, Aunt Teeks, at first no one has any idea who might want to see the old man dead, but as Suzanne and Grace begin to dig into his life, they discover that there was much more to the man than they first thought, including several motives for murder.

When the new attorney in April Springs is found dead soon after a public spat with Jake, Suzanne and her husband must team up to solve the woman's murder before they are both set up to take the fall for a crime neither one committed. Added to the intrigue in her life is news from Suzanne's mother that very well may change the donut maker's life forever.
